@FlameRaptorRaven rated the Algeria vs Argentina game 7.7 out of 10 in FIFA on June 17, 2026. Final score: Algeria 0 – Argentina 3. Group J. Fan ratings and discussion on RateGame.

Argentina had control of this game most of the way despite Algeria’s valiant resistance. However, there will be 1 man on everyone’s lips after this game. At the risk of sounding too complimentary, I have watched Messi for so long and he keeps finding new ways to surprise me. At the age of 38, turning 39 next Wednesday (June 24th), Messi scored a hat trick in a vintage performance. The first one was a powerful shot the keeper couldn’t stop, the next was him being in the right spot at the right time to pounce on a mistake and the third one was a perfectly placed shot. He is just phenomenal. It wasn’t just the goals. He was the engine for Argentina and galvanized the team to victory just as much with his passing as he did his goalscoring. Aside from him, the entire Argentinian team was so composed. Never panicking and always ready. They clearly learned from their mistakes back in 2022. With all that being said, this was still a blowout. Doesn’t mean I can’t appreciate the greatness.
